pedantisch
pedantic, overly fussy, nit-picking
adjective pe-DAN-tish Rare
Origin: from Italian pedante (pedant)
Usage Note
Pedantisch describes excessive attention to rules or details at the expense of the bigger picture. Er ist so pedantisch, dass er jeden Tippfehler kommentiert. Mostly negative, though in technical fields careful accuracy can be valued.
Examples
"Die pedantische Korrektorin strich jeden fehlenden Beistrich an."
Natural Translation
The pedantic editor marked every missing comma.
Literal Translation
The pedantic proofreader underlined every missing comma.
